Output 83fafc63d24240ad257448928ce80874d5418cc2cf594fbd4ce3c736c96c638b: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caa730f7fdfebd620db1f54c23117543fd53c24c OP_EQUAL
address
3LAYhwusgY5chSSPuqqmtcB8vU9U8pvGM1
transaction
83fafc63d24240ad257448928ce80874d5418cc2cf594fbd4ce3c736c96c638b
spent
true